WHEA 0-124 BSOD are almost always malfunctioning hardware.
Some options are:
a) run software tests on the hardware components
b) swap test hardware components
c) obtain service at a local computer store
d) customer / warranty support

According to description, it may be related to storport.sys, stornvme.sys file occurred.
But for WHEA_UNCORRECTABLE_ERROR (124), it always means primarily hardware issues, but can be compatibility or low-level driver issues.
So please check for update to install new security update. It will update system file and driver version.
Or I consider that you could download driver from the manufacturer's official website.

I have the same problem, solved this uninstaling the realtek audio driver and disabling hdmi nvidia audio in nvidia control pannel, Seems that is a conflict between realtek and nvidia.
